GH Engage is partnering with a leading MEP Contractor who has recently secured a flagship mixed use design & build scheme in the London Bridge region which is valued in excess of £40 million MEP. Currently in pre-construction, my client is seeking an experienced M&E Quantity Surveyor who has been involved in either commercial, healthcare or residential projects upwards of £20 million M&E who has the hunger to progress into Commercial Management and lead a major project in London.
- Proven aptitude for strategic client engagement, with the ability to cultivate long-term, commercially valuable stakeholder networks.
- Demonstrates the confidence and adaptability to excel in situations and embrace scope beyond their immediate comfort zone.
- Established record of delivering flagship MEP schemes (circa £20m+) within tier-one or large-scale project environments, consistently meeting programme, commercial, and quality objectives.
